The specialized freight trucking industry in the United States is a significant economic force, worth over $125 billion annually. This robust sector is experiencing steady growth, driven primarily by nationwide infrastructure projects and the increasing demand for renewable energy transport.
Scale is a defining characteristic of this industry, with more than 10 million oversize/overweight permits issued annually across the country. These permits primarily facilitate the transport of construction equipment, generators, turbines, and agricultural machinery.
Most heavy hauls involve substantial loads weighing between 40,000 to 120,000 pounds and spanning up to 20 feet wide, highlighting the specialized expertise required for safe and efficient transport.
California stands out among the top three states for oversize transport demand, a position attributed to its bustling ports, extensive agricultural operations, and thriving technology manufacturing centers.
Coastal states like California face additional complexity due to environmental protection zones along transport routes, with approximately 15% of heavy hauls involving marine-related industries.
Customer expectations in this specialized industry are clear and demanding. A recent industry survey revealed that 92% of heavy equipment buyers consider on-time delivery and damage-free transport their top priorities.

All oversize loads entering the City of Lewisport must conform to the requirements set by the Kentucky Transportation Cabinet.
In general, any vehicle over 12 feet in width, 14.5 feet in height, and within the Class A weight class should obtain an oversize load permit from the Lewisport Public Works Department.
The City of Lewisport has specific regulations regarding oversized loads during peak construction seasons (March-May and September-November), requiring additional permits and escorts.
According to the Lewisport Police Department, escort vehicles are required for oversized loads exceeding 14 feet in width or 16 feet in height. A $100 fee applies for police escorts, with a minimum of 24 hours' notice.
To apply for permits in Lewisport, please visit the Public Works Department's website at [www.lewisportky.gov](http://www.lewisportky.gov) or call (270) 756-2135. A completed application form and required documentation are necessary for permit issuance.
The City of Lewisport restricts oversized loads from traveling on Main Street during peak tourist season (June-August) between 10 am and 5 pm, Monday through Saturday. Sunday restrictions apply only to northbound traffic.
During winter weather conditions, the City may impose temporary load restrictions for vehicles exceeding 10 tons in weight.
The standard permit fee for Lewisport is $100, with additional fees applying based on route complexity and load size. Fees range from $50 to $500, depending on the requirements.
